    Abstract: A method and system for integrating multiple factors into a unified optimization model for retail network configuration, in one aspect, obtains input data for modeling store configuration. The input data may include demand of each merchandise category from each customer segment in each facility, geographic distribution of stores in an area, current revenue of stores, and physical cost of reconfiguring stores. A trade area is generated as a function of store location, store format, and store capacity. The method and system also generates trade area demand summation representing predicted total demand of all stores for all merchandise categories for all customer segments in the trade area, as a function of store location, store format, store capacity, merchandise category, and customer segment associated with the trade area. An objective function is constructed as a function of said trade area demand summation, current revenue of stores, and physical cost of reconfiguring stores.

    Abstract: A USB connector for connecting with a USB female includes a rotating shaft assembly which is capable of rotating, metal legs, a connecting line, and a substrate. The rotating shaft assembly includes a rotating shaft, a rotating shaft sleeve and a rotating shaft support. The rotating shaft is disposed in the rotating shaft sleeve and is capable of rotating relative to the rotating shaft sleeve. The rotating shaft sleeve is located in a support hole of the rotating shaft support. The rotating shaft assembly with the rotating shaft support is fixed on the surface of the substrate by the rotating shaft support. The metal legs are formed on the surface of the substrate to ensure the connecting strength of the metal legs and reduce the thickness of the USB device.

    Abstract: The embodiments of the present disclosure provide a user device, which includes a main body part, a movable part electrically connected with the main body part, and a switching control unit and a rotation driver unit for co-axially connecting the main body part with the movable part. The switching control unit is used for eliminating a friction that enables the main body part to be fixed relative to the movable part fixed to turn on a rotation mode of the movable part. The rotation driver unit is used for applying a pre-pressing elastic force to the movable part when the switching control unit turns on the rotation mode of the movable part, so as to enable the movable part to automatically rotate relative to the main body part. The pre-pressing elastic force is less than the friction.

    Abstract: A Universal Serial Bus (USB) modem is provided. The USB modem includes a USB plug (1), a Printed Circuit Board (PCB) (2), and a signal input apparatus (3) that connects the USB plug (1) and the PCB (2). The signal input apparatus includes: a support (4) that is disposed on the PCB (2), in which the USB plug is disposed on the support (4); and a connector (5) that is disposed on the PCB and capable of being connected to the USB plug (5). The USB modem implements signal input by adopting the connector (5), thereby extending the service life of the USB modem and greatly reducing the cost.

    Abstract: This invention discloses a rotating mechanism and an electronic device. The rotating mechanism includes a base assembly, a rotator assembly, and a riveting gasket. The base assembly is riveted to the riveting gasket; the rotator assembly is sheathed to the base assembly, the riveting gasket restricts the rotator assembly onto the base assembly, and the rotator assembly can rotate against the base assembly around an axial direction; and the rotator assembly includes at least one elastomer, a concave-convex structure on the base assembly engages with a concave-convex structure on the elastomer to fix the rotator assembly and the base assembly. The total axial thickness of the rotating mechanism in this invention is very small, the outer diameter of the rotating mechanism is also very small, and therefore, the rotating mechanism fits in well with an ultra-thin electronic device.

    Abstract: A method for performing a photolithography process includes providing a reticle on a projection apparatus, the reticle having a test pattern defined thereon, the test pattern including a plurality of one-dimensional structures and a plurality of two-dimensional structures. The test pattern defined on the reticle is transferred to at least one area on a wafer. The projection apparatus is focused on the test pattern transferred on the wafer during a photolithography process to perform a process monitoring.

    Abstract: A system and method is disclosed for determining intervals of a space filling curve in a query box. The method includes the operation of providing a range query-box contained within a data set, wherein the data set has a plurality of elements in N dimensions. A space filling curve is applied to the data set. The space filling curve contacts each of the elements in the N dimensions. The space filling curve is also applied to a range-query box contained within the data set. An entry point of the space filling curve into the query box is determined. A first endpoint box is formed to cover an hquad of the space filling curve at the entry point that includes P×P elements, with a first value of P selected as one. The value of P is increased to expand the endpoint box around a next larger hquad of the space filling curve, until a size of the endpoint box is maximized without exiting the range-query box. The interval of the space filling curve in the endpoint box can then be determined.

    Abstract: An electronic device with a USB connector is provided, which is designed for solving a problem in the conventional art that a USB cap on an electronic device may easily get lost. The electronic device with the USB connector includes an outer housing, an intermediate housing located inside the outer housing and moveable relative to the outer housing, and a circuit board located inside the intermediate housing. The USB connector is disposed on the intermediate housing, and electrically connected to the circuit board. A USB connector through hole is configured on the outer housing at a position corresponding to the USB connector. The electronic device further includes an elastic apparatus disposed in a moving direction of the intermediate housing, and an intermediate housing movement positioning apparatus. The technology is applicable to electronic devices with a USB connector such as a wireless USB Modem or a USB flash drive.
